Roles of Stakeholders

ScholarshipFoundation

ProjectManagement

Team

Students

Encouragers

-Express and Dispatch their dream and passion for their futures-Monthly Video Report

-Registers their students data-Gives scholarships and encouragement messages-Monthly Video Report

-Updates students data-Translates video (if needed)-Sends scholarships and messages to foundations-Develops and manages the website

-Donate scholarships-Encourage students-Interactive communication-Tell others about students who they donated

Business Model

-20% Margin Fee

-Website Ads

If a student needs 120$ per a year, advertise as 150$.After the scholarship has been gathered,we can get 30$ per 1 student.

When this website as global community gets larger,Ads on this site also gets more profitable.1page view=1yen=0.7tk

-CSR MatchingThis service is easy to see ROI and also to get reputations among peoplefor companies looking for the best CSR way.
